While online lotteries are legal in most jurisdictions, some states have yet to fully embrace the technology. In fact, only seven states currently offer online lottery play. Some states also require that customers be residents of their state to play their lottery games. For some states, such as Pennsylvania, it is not legal to sell lottery tickets online. The law says that such an approach could create problems.

Despite the legal concerns surrounding online lottery games, these websites are a safe bet. They use geolocation technology to verify a customer’s location and ensure that they are within the state. This ensures that spoofing technology cannot be used. Additionally, the online lottery sites use simple instructions for customers to play.
